MrBeast Builds 100 Homes For Families In Need
July 2, 2024
Popular YouTuber MrBeast, whose real name is James Stephen Donaldson, has built 100 homes and given them away to people in need.
The homes were constructed for families in Jamaica, El Salvador, Argentina, and Colombia.

Credit: MrBeast
MrBeast, known for his philanthropic endeavors and viral challenges, shared the news in his latest video, capturing the emotional reactions of the families as they received their new homes.
"Each home is going to change a family's life," MrBeast said, highlighting the profound impact of this initiative.
In addition to the homes, MrBeast surprised all of the children in one village with brand-new bicycles, bringing smiles and joy to the community.
The ambitious project was made possible through the support of numerous partners, including Food For The Poor, New Story, and Techo. MrBeast also extended his gratitude to his loyal viewers, acknowledging their crucial role in the endeavor.
"And also shout out to you guys, because obviously if you didn't watch these videos, we wouldn't have been able to build 100 houses," he said.
